ENVIRONMENTAL PROTECTION AGENCY
[ER-FRL-6648-4]
Environmental Impact Statements and Regulations; Availability of
EPA Comments
Availability of EPA comments prepared pursuant to the Environmental
Review Process (ERP), under section 309 of the Clean Air Act and
section 102(2)(c) of the National Environmental Policy Act as amended.
Requests for copies of EPA comments can be directed to the Office of
Federal Activities at (202) 564-7167. An explanation of the
[[Page 7215]]
ratings assigned to draft environmental impact statements (EISs) was
published in FR dated April 04, 2003 (68 FR 16511).
Draft EISs
ERP No. D-AFS-J65397-WY Rating LO, Woodrock Project, Proposal for
Timber Sale, Travel Management and Watershed Restoration,
Implementation, Bighorn National Forest, Tongue Ranger District,
Sheridan County, WY.
Summary: EPA has lack of objections to the proposed action based on
the predicted overall improvement of forest resource conditions. EPA
suggests that the final EIS provide qantification sediment from erosion
estimates and monitor water quality and habitat quality in streams.
ERP No. D-AFS-K65265-AZ Rating LO, Bar T Bar Anderson Springs
Allotment Management Plans to Authorize Permitted Livestock Grazing for
a 10-Year Period, Coconino National Forest, Mogollon Rim and Mormon
Lake Ranger District, Coconino County, AZ.
Summary: EPA has no objections to the Preferred Alternative but EPA
requested more detailed information for monitoring, specifically
impacts to vegetation.
ERP No. D-AFS-L65444-OR Rating LO, Eyerly Fire Salvage Project,
Burned and Damaged Trees Salvage, Reforestation and Fuels Treatment,
Implementation, Deschutes National Forest, Sisters Ranger District,
Jefferson County, OR.
Summary: While EPA has no objection to the proposed action it did
request clarification on consultation with Tribes, Environmental
Justice and measures to protect workers from health risks associated
with the use of fire retardants.
ERP No. D-DOE-E09014-KY Rating EC1, Paducah, Kentucky, Site
Depleted Uranium Hexafluoride Conversion Facility, Construction and
Operation, McCraken County, KY.
Summary: EPA expressed environmental concerns regarding the
capability and capacity of the two disposal facilities to accept the
proposed waste products from the Paducah conversion facility. EPA
requested that DOE include this information in the final EIS.
